Ticket: Staging env misconfigured for Siftgate bloom filter

The bloom layer in front of the Pellet KV store is rejecting all lookups in staging because the env file was copied from the dev template without credentials. False-positive tuning values are fine; only the auth line is missing. To unblock the weekly demo, the Pellet admission secret must be set on the following line.

env line for yaguf-fajop: LEDGER_TOKEN13=fb08984397349

Changelog — ConsentCurtain 1.8 (key rotation). Quick heads-up for review: we rotated the deploy key used to push the consent banner bundle to edge nodes, same cadence as last quarter, nothing scary. The rollout itself is unchanged — banner ships to the Novarra region first, then everywhere Thursday. Old key is revoked, CI secrets updated, and all pipeline runs since Tuesday are signed with the replacement. Audit trail is attached to the release record. For your verification checklist, the new signing key is below.

signing key of bagap-yawep = bky13_TbfT6ZMUoGJo2

## Step 2: Enable the consent banner

Applies to all Murkfield-hosted frontends. The banner ships behind a flag; do not enable it globally until legal sign-off is recorded in the rollout tracker. Enable per-region, starting with the Torvale pilot. The banner blocks analytics scripts until consent is granted — expect a temporary drop in metrics and do not file incidents for it. Rollback is the flag, nothing else. Cache TTLs mean changes take up to ten minutes to propagate. Set the flag service to the values below.

service settings:
PRAIX_LOG_LEVEL=error
PRAIX_METRICS_HOST=metrics.praix.qorvelcorp.corp
PRAIX_POOL_SIZE=16